THREE people arrested in connection with the death of a man in Keighley remain in custody.

Two men and one woman were arrested on suspicion of murder following the death of a man in his 40s.

West Yorkshire Police were initially called to reports of a man who was injured at 3.56am in Keighley on Thursday, April 8.

Emergency services rushed to a property on Fell Lane, Exley Head and found a man in his 40s with a serious injury.

He was taken to hospital but was pronounced dead shortly after.

A police spokesman confirmed those arrested remain in police custody today.

Police have issued an appeal to the public, as part of their investigation into the death.
